Cast iron stoves are sought-after by those who want a more traditional appearance. Cast iron is more robust and more dense, which means it takes longer to heat up than a stove made of steel, but it holds its heat much longer. This is a great option if you need the warmth to last until the early hours of the morning.

A multifuel stove is designed to heat your home using a combination of different fuels, such as logs, coal, and pellets. Cast iron is a durable and robust material. The textured surface of cast iron will develop a natural patina with time, giving your stove a classic appearance. Cast iron is also very energy-efficient, releasing heat into the room quickly and keeping it for longer durations of time than other types of wood-burning stoves.

Cast iron stoves are also extremely durable, requiring minimal maintenance beyond cleaning. They are typically finished with a protective coating that helps prevent them from rusting. This keeps them in good shape for a long time. Certain coatings are available in a broad variety of colors, making it simple to choose a hue that is suitable for your home decor. In addition there are multifuel stoves constructed from stainless steel, which is resistant to corrosion and easier to clean than cast iron.
